NewLead Holdings Expands by Acquiring Kritsas Fleet Amid Vessel Arrests
In a significant move, NewLead Holdings announced its acquisition of Greece's Kritsas Shipping as of March 22, 2023. This deal involved a complete takeover of 100% of the share capital from Dimitrios Kritsas through a share transfer agreement, leading to the rebranding of the company to Newlead Shipmanagement SA. The acquisition also included two handymax bulk carriers, namely Aurora Onyx and Aurora Pearl, which are notable for their respective deadweight tonnages of 47,305 dwt and 46,709 dwt, built in 2002 and 2000. Notably, these vessels, along with their holding entities Onyx Corporation SA and Pearl Corporation SA, were purchased for a mere $1 each, as outlined in NewLead's financial results for the fiscal year 2015. However, NewLead's ownership of the Aurora Onyx was brief, as the vessel was arrested on April 15, 2023, due to defaulting on the terms of its mortgage agreement with HSBC, originally signed on November 23, 2010. The situation further escalated, with the Aurora Pearl also under a mortgage from HSBC. Following court proceedings, South African authorities ordered the sale of the Aurora Onyx on May 19, and the vessel was subsequently delivered to its new owners on May 25, 2023, according to statements from NewLead.
